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Colnbrook to Bath is to bus via Heathrow Central Bus Station which costs £7 - £45 and takes 2h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Colnbrook to Bath is to drive which takes 1h 42m and costs £23 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Colnbrook to Bath station. However, there are services departing from Lakeside Road and arriving at Bus Station via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 41m.
The distance between Colnbrook and Bath is 92 miles. The road distance is 95 miles.
The best way to get from Colnbrook to Bath without a car is to bus and train which takes 2h 8m and costs £35 - £120.
It takes approximately 2h 8m to get from Colnbrook to Bath, including transfers.
Colnbrook to Bath b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Heathrow Central Bus Station.
Colnbrook to Bath b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Colnbrook to Bath is 95 miles. It takes approximately 1h 42m to drive from Colnbrook to Bath.

What companies run services between Colnbrook, England and Bath, England?
FlixBus operates a bus from Heathrow Central Bus Station to Bus Station every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£7–17 and the journey takes 2h 15m. National Express also services this route every 2 hours.
